Hi all,

I have two goldfish currently, and one of them recently had a part of their fin turn a whitish color. I've heard about fin rot but from what I understand, that begins at the edges of the fin and works downward toward the body. This discoloration happened from the bottom up. Recently, the top of the fin started fraying. I do not see anything strange about the fish's behavior or notice anything different besides that white stripe on his fin. It does appear that the base of the fin where the white stripe begins is a little swollen.

I've been staying on top of the water changes, and my latest water test (a few days ago) showed that all parameters were good. Really not sure what this is, would appreciate any input.

Thank you

I would add some aquarium salt 1 table for 2 gallons for one week it looks like a deformed fin ray  looks like a lump at the base of  the fin ray if you notice it getting worse after 5 days than I would do a course of maracyn2 in food active ingredient minocycline has anti-inflammatory properties
